Blood groups ABO and Rh (D) factor in the rheumatic diseases.

The researches of Cohen, Boyd, Goldwasser, Cathcart, and Heisler (1963) on a small number of patients with chronic joint disease of different clinical types showed that there was no association between the ABO blood groups and the chronic rheumatic diseases, but that there was a deficiency of Rh factor.
